Transaction 257412420955a38bacfbe432ae54ffe5e7dd42bb395766da2dd1c2747aecb066
1 Input
1 Output
-
257412420955a38bacfbe432ae54ffe5e7dd42bb395766da2dd1c2747aecb066:0
- value
- 350920
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c745394fcc6e66d45c9f83c43aa1d99e4a29837c OP_EQUAL
- address
- 3KrfKUdAhpkGNaXoz4TsXqg5G3RVyhGDoo